export interface APIExtendedInvite extends APIInvitehttps://discord.com/developers/docs/resources/invite#invite-metadata-object
optionalexternalapproximate_member_count? : number 
Approximate count of total members, returned from the GET /invites/<code> endpoint when with_counts is true
Inherited from: APIInvite
optionalexternalapproximate_presence_count? : number 
Approximate count of online members, returned from the GET /invites/<code> endpoint when with_counts is true
Inherited from: APIInvite
externalchannel : Required<APIPartialChannel> | null 
The channel this invite is forSee https://discord.com/developers/docs/resources/channel#channel-object
Inherited from: APIInvite
externalcreated_at : string 
When this invite was created
The expiration date of this invite, returned from the GET /invites/<code> endpoint when with_expiration is true
Inherited from: APIInvite
optionalexternalguild_scheduled_event? : APIGuildScheduledEvent 
The guild scheduled event data, returned from the GET /invites/<code> endpoint when guild_scheduled_event_id is a valid guild scheduled event id
Inherited from: APIInvite
optionalexternalguild? : APIInviteGuild 
The guild this invite is forSee https://discord.com/developers/docs/resources/guild#guild-object
Inherited from: APIInvite
optionalexternalinviter? : APIUser 
The user who created the inviteSee https://discord.com/developers/docs/resources/user#user-object
Inherited from: APIInvite
externalmax_age : number 
Duration (in seconds) after which the invite expires
externalmax_uses : number 
Max number of times this invite can be used
optionalexternalstage_instance? : APIInviteStageInstance 
The stage instance data if there is a public stage instance in the stage channel this invite is for
Inherited from: APIInvite
optionalexternaltarget_application? : Partial<APIApplication> 
The embedded application to open for this voice channel embedded application inviteSee https://discord.com/developers/docs/resources/application#application-object
Inherited from: APIInvite
optionalexternaltarget_type? : InviteTargetType 
The type of target for this voice channel inviteSee https://discord.com/developers/docs/resources/invite#invite-object-invite-target-types
Inherited from: APIInvite
optionalexternaltarget_user? : APIUser 
The user whose stream to display for this voice channel stream inviteSee https://discord.com/developers/docs/resources/user#user-object
Inherited from: APIInvite
externaltemporary : boolean 
Whether this invite only grants temporary membership
externaluses : number 
Number of times this invite has been used